## Diagram: Transparent AI Venn Diagram
### Overview
The image is a Venn diagram illustrating the relationship between Interpretability, Explainability, and Transparent AI. The diagram uses three overlapping hexagons, each representing one of these concepts. The central overlapping region represents the intersection of all three.
### Components/Axes
The diagram consists of three labeled hexagons:
* **Interpretability:** Located on the left side, colored light blue. Label: "Model transparency and understanding".
* **Explainability:** Located on the right side, colored light green. Label: "Post-decision reasoning and justification".
* **Transparent AI:** Located at the top, not colored, but the overlapping region is gray. Label: "Models that are both understandable and justifiable".

### Key Observations
The diagram emphasizes that Transparent AI is achieved when a model is both interpretable and explainable. The diagram suggests that Interpretability and Explainability are distinct but related concepts, and both are necessary for achieving Transparent AI. The overlapping areas indicate that some aspects of a model can be both interpretable and explainable simultaneously.
### Interpretation
The diagram illustrates a conceptual framework for understanding the different facets of AI transparency. It suggests that simply having a model that is understandable (Interpretability) or having a model that can justify its decisions (Explainability) is not enough. True transparency requires both qualities to be present. The diagram is a high-level conceptual illustration and does not contain any quantitative data.
